MED 0 Posted December 31, 2017 Share Posted December 31, 2017 I want to use Evernote for daily journaling. My needs are quite simple: create a capability where each morning I write answers to a few simple prompts (e.g. what am I grateful for today, etc). I have my own prompts I want to use (e.g. I'm not shopping for someone else's journal template). I have searched and read a number of articles on templates in Evernote, but they are either for business teams or seem to be excessively convoluted. Here's the simple flow I'm hoping to achieve: 1. Each morning I create a new note in my "2018 Daily Journal" notebook 2. When the new note opens, it automatically has the prompts. 3. I write my answers and close. Simple. That's what I'm trying to accomplish. Thoughts? Link to post

I use a script on my Mac to create my daily journal note (documented here) It copies the template and sets the title, tags ... and inserts an entry into the calendar Evernote notes don't have a prompt feature however the script can be modified to prompt for input, and append the response to the journal note Link to post
